From JK Rowling to Stephen Fry, Hollywood mourns 'Harry Potter' star Alan Rickman's death
LOS ANGELES: Many celebrities including writers JK Rowling, EL James, Stephen Fry, Eddie Izzard, Michael Ball among others paid tribute to British actor Alan Rickman, who died from cancer at the age of 69.

"The actor and director Alan Rickman has died from cancer at the age of 69. He was surrounded by family and friends," a family statement said today.

" Harry Potter" author Rowling led the tributes to the star, who was famous as Professor Severus Snape in the movie adaptation of the best-selling novel.
